Yazoo City's location in the Mississippi Delta means homes here contend with heavy clay soils that shift and settle, putting constant stress on underground pipes. Add in humid subtropical summers that push air conditioners and plumbing systems to their limits, and you have a recipe for repairs. The housing stock in Yazoo City includes many older homes built before modern plumbing codes, often with galvanized steel or cast iron pipes that corrode over time. Newer subdivisions have PVC, but even they face the same soil challenges. Why Plumber Costs Vary in Yazoo City
Several Yazoo City-specific factors influence plumbing costs. The region's expansive clay soil can cause pipes to shift or break, making excavation and repair more labor-intensive. Many homes in older parts of town have outdated pipe materials like galvanized steel, which are harder to work with and may require full replacement. Mississippi's humid climate accelerates corrosion in metal pipes and can lead to mold issues that complicate repairs. The local labor market also plays a role: Yazoo City's smaller population means fewer plumbers, which can affect availability and pricing. Additionally, permits are typically required for major work, and your plumber will need to pull them through the city's permitting office, adding to the project timeline and cost. Seasonal demand spikes during summer and winter freezes can also drive up rates.
Common Plumbing Issues in Yazoo City Homes
- 1
Slab Leaks
Expansive clay soils in Yazoo City can shift the foundation, causing water lines under concrete slabs to crack or rupture. This is a frequent issue in older neighborhoods.
- 2
Clogged Drains from Hard Water
Mississippi's hard water leaves mineral deposits inside pipes, leading to slow drains and blockages. This is especially common in homes with older galvanized pipes.
- 3
Frozen Pipes in Winter
Though Yazoo City has mild winters, occasional hard freezes can cause pipes in uninsulated crawl spaces or exterior walls to burst, particularly in older homes.
- 4
Sewer Line Backups
Tree roots seeking moisture in the clay soil often invade sewer lines, causing backups. This is a recurring problem in established neighborhoods with large trees.
- 5
Water Heater Failure
Sediment buildup from hard water shortens the lifespan of water heaters. Many Yazoo City homes require replacement every 8-10 years due to this issue.

Plumber cost FAQs — Yazoo City.
What factors affect plumber cost in Yazoo City?
Plumber costs in Yazoo City depend on the job type, materials needed, and labor time. Emergency calls after hours or during holidays cost more. The age of your home and pipe material also matter—older galvanized pipes are harder to repair. Seasonal demand, such as during summer AC drain issues or winter freeze repairs, can increase rates. Always get a written estimate before work begins.
How do I choose a plumber in Yazoo City?
Look for a plumber licensed in Mississippi and insured. Ask for references from local homeowners, and check online reviews. Get at least three quotes for major jobs. A good plumber will explain the problem and provide a detailed estimate. Avoid paying large sums upfront, and ensure the contract includes a warranty on labor and parts.
What are Mississippi's plumbing licensing requirements?
In Mississippi, plumbers must be licensed by the Mississippi Board of Plumbing Examiners. This ensures they have passed exams and met experience requirements. Always verify a plumber's license before hiring. For major work, the plumber should also pull a permit with your local building department to ensure code compliance.
When is the best time to schedule plumbing work in Yazoo City?
Spring and fall are ideal for non-emergency plumbing projects, as weather is mild and demand is lower. Avoid scheduling during peak summer (when AC drain issues spike) or after a hard freeze (when burst pipes cause high demand). If you have a planned project, book a few weeks in advance to secure availability.
Do I need a permit for plumbing work in Yazoo City?
Major plumbing work, such as repiping, sewer line replacement, or water heater installation, typically requires a permit from the city's permitting office. Your plumber should handle the permit process. Minor repairs like faucet fixes usually don't need one. Permits ensure work meets Mississippi plumbing code and passes inspection.
